This interactive e-zine provides a dynamic reading experience that focuses on thinking, being, and living in ways that resist the norms of a capitalist culture. Using a series of short articles, advertising content, art, and more, the authors address ideas of consumerism, monetization, life direction and purpose, and finding happiness and joy in life.
